[Kernel-packages] [Bug 1860940] Re: Cannot read /sys/devices/platform/hp-wmi/tablet

2020-01-26 Thread You-Sheng Yang
[6.411465] hp_wmi: query 0xd returned error 0x5 Where 0xd=HPWMI_FEATURE2_QUERY, and 0x5=HPWMI_RET_INVALID_PARAMETERS. This has been resolved in https://bugzilla.redhat.com/show_bug.cgi?id=1520703 by upstream commit 133b2acee387 ("platform/x86: hp-wmi: Make buffer for HPWMI_FEATURE2_QUERY 128
